Link copied to clipboard
Home Global team blog Which Country Has the Best Developers? Ukraine Ranks in the Top 5

Which Country Has the Best Developers? Ukraine Ranks in the Top 5

Top-rated software development company

Get hand-selected expert engineers to supplement your team or build a high-quality mobile/web app from scratch.

Contact us

There are currently around 200K developers in Ukraine, more than 4K tech companies, and 100+ companies from the Fortune 500 who have chosen Ukraine as one of the best countries for hiring programmers. Ukraine takes leading positions in the global rankings of IT destinations but you can hire a software development team in other regions like Central Europe and Latin America. Keep reading to learn more about the list of the best programmers by country in the Eastern European and global tech talent markets.

Which Country Has the Best Developers?

According to the SkillValue Report with the best programmers by country, based on 550+ technical assessments,

Top 10 countries with the best programmers in the world

  • Slovakia
  • Mexico
  • Poland
  • Hungary
  • Ukraine
  • Chech Republic
  • Spain
  • Austria
  • Switzerland
  • Germany

Which country has the best developers? Ukraine is among the top 5 | SkillValue 2019 

Ukraine ranks in the top 5 countries with the world’s best programmers. Hungary comes 4th, Poland takes 3rd place, Mexico is on the 2nd position, while Slovakia takes 1st place. 

Ukrainian programmers are constantly mastering their skills – they moved up to 5th place with an average score index of 93,17% in comparison to the previous research showing 91,26%. 

The growing tech talent market fosters outsourcing to Ukraine and keeps gaining popularity among foreign business owners. Tech talent quality and availability are the top factors considered, however, the average cost for developers is also important. 

Guide to Nearshore Software Development in Eastern Europe

Software development market statistics of the tech countries — Poland, Ukraine, Romania, Czech Republic, Hungary, Bulgaria, Belarus, and Croatia.

Best Programmers by Country in Europe

  1. Slovakia 
  2. Poland
  3. Hungary
  4. Ukraine
  5. Czech republic 

Ukraine is one of the top 5 countries with the best developers in Europe and takes 4th place. The Czech Republic takes the 5th position, Hungary ranks 3rd, Poland is 2nd, while Slovakia is the 1st among the countries with the top programmers in the world. 


Which country has the best programmers in Europe? Ukraine comes 4th | SkillValue 2019 

Why Ukraine Has the Best Web Developers for Hire in 2021?

Which Country Has the Best Developers in 2021? Ukraine Ranks in the Top 5

Why is Ukraine the best country for web developers?

  1. Ukraine ranks among the top 5 countries with the best developers in the world according to a SkillValue report of the best programmers by country.
  2. Ukraine is one of the top 5 countries with the best coders in the world in Europe, taking 4th place.
  3. The number of highly qualified developers keeps growing — currently, it has reached a whopping 200K web developers for hire, while the number is expected to grow to 242K by 2025

Which Country Has the Best Programmers? HackerRank

According to HackerRank, the top 5 countries with the best web developers are:

  • China
  • Russia
  • Poland
  • Switzerland
  • Hungary

Best programmers by country | HackerRank

HackerRank, a leading tech platform that analyzes data from more than 1.5 million members, posted an extensive ranking of the countries with the best programmers, as well as breakdowns by specific competencies like algorithms, data structures, AI, and security.

We were especially happy to find out that Ukraine came 11th in the overall ranking. Surprisingly, the US came in 28th despite being home to a huge number of tech companies and industry luminaries like Bill Gates and Dennis Ritchie. 

Similarly, some of the world’s most popular outsourcing destinations like Vietnam, India, and Pakistan placed far down the list (in 23rd, 31st, and 50th places respectively).


Which country has the best developers | Hackerrank

When the rankings are disaggregated by skill, Ukrainian programmers top the list with the best cyber-security knowledge and are in the top 5 when it comes to mathematics and distributed systems skills.

In our LinkedIn study, we also found that the tech talent pool in Ukraine is wide, outperforming such tech hubs as Germany, the Netherlands, the UK, and the US — there are 8K JavaScript programmers, 9K PHP developers, 8K Java software engineers.

China ranked well in a number of domains: data structures, mathematics, and functional programming. Russia dominates in algorithms, the domain with the most popular challenges.


Countries with the best web developers by domain | HakerRank

Why Outsource to Ukraine?

Get data on the state of the Ukrainian IT market and discover why Ukraine is one of the top destinations for outsourcing software development in 2022.

Where Can You Find Best Web Developers in the World?  

Ben Frederickson, a software developer from Vancouver BC, compiled research on the countries with the best web developers in the world and here are the top 5 countries with the best coders in the world according to his research: 

  • United States
  • China    
  • India        
  • United Kingdom     
  • Germany

The study is based on the GitHub Users Accounts that have had public activity throughout the last 7 years. The dependence between population and the number of GitHub accounts affected the results obtained. 

The United States has more GitHub accounts than populations of some of the European countries, so you can't really expect them to be competitive when ranking simply by the number of GitHub accounts. 

To get more clear results, the data was also calculated according to the relation between the number of accounts and GDP. According to this estimation, the top country with best programmers is Ukraine. 

As Ben Frederickson says: “Former Soviet states: Ukraine, Belarus, Serbia, and Moldova rank highly as all have more GitHub accounts than would be predicted by their respective GDP's. 

In particular, Ukraine seems to be the best bet in terms of getting a deal on hiring a remote developer: there is plenty of Ukrainian talent available at what I imagine must be reasonable rates.”


Ukraine is the best country to hire web developers

How to Hire Web Developers | 5 Tips From Experts That Work

We have interviewed a dozen of companies to reveal the tactics to help you hire web developers. These are:

how-hire-web-developers-dragappThe interview with Eduarda Bardavid,

Co-Founder and CEO at DragApp


  • Interview candidates in three phases to assess them from different perspectives each time.
  • The first interview is a high-level conversation to understand the candidate’s background. The second - to test technical skills. This phase is a mix of technical questions and assessment of previous experience in software development. The third interview is dedicated to behavioral questions. 
  • Request and evaluate examples of previous projects candidates have developed.
  • Dismiss candidates that are brilliant technically but neither demonstrate team player skills nor fit your work environment.


how-hire-web-developers-michelle-ridsdale-envatoThe interview with Michelle Ridsdale,

the Chief People Officer at Envato.


  • The software engineering interview process is composed of three stages. The first stage involves a Values and Technical Interview, the second is a Technical Coding Challenge, and the third stage is a Technical and Behavioural Interview. 
  • Don’t base your hiring decisions solely on skills; this can potentially create issues with workplace culture and collaboration, so look at values-fit as well.


how-hire-web-developers-kevin-miller-open-listingsThe interview with Kevin Miller,

the Director of Growth at Open Listings


  • The interview process typically consists of 2–3 rounds where the candidate meets with the core members of the team, the founders, and the people they’d be working with most closely. 
  • Find people who are excited about building something that has a lot of potential from the ground up.
  • Disregard those who are only interested in luxury benefits that big companies can offer. 


how-hire-web-developers-jostleThe interview with Brad Palmer,

the CEO and co-founder of Jostle


  • We interview to determine if the candidate has the required technical skills and knowledge. Then we debrief while the candidate is waiting in another room. If the result is positive, the second interview happens right away. After this, both interview teams come together to make the final call. We know what we need and when we spot it, we hire immediately.
  • Only hire people who thrive in challenging and creative environments.


how-hire-web-developers-josh-horwitz-coo-cofounderThe interview with Josh Horwitz,

Co-Founder and COO at PasswordPing


  • We start with initial phone screens first with the recruiter (30 minutes) and then with the hiring manager (one hour). 
  • Start interviews with asking candidates what they know about your company and why they’re interested in the role you’re offering.
  • Look for tech skills first and foremost, then experience with the technologies you use, then cultural fit.
  • Discard candidates who: lie on their resume, hide their skill gaps, aren’t passionate about learning new technologies. 


If you’re interested in hiring talented tech professionals to augment your distributed team, just contact us and we’ll help you based on your specific business needs. We do staff augmentation and take care of office space, equipment, support staff, and workstation and taxes for developers, allowing you to focus solely on business development.

Don’t know where to start?
Contact us

Grid Dynamics Writers Team

Grid Dynamics Writers Team is a team of passionate creative writers, content marketers, designers who vigorously research internet as well as cooperate with developers and our recruitment team to provide you with top-notch material about tech, salary trends, development team hiring and management tips as well as up-to-date information about IT tech talent market around the world.

Rate this article
(12 reviews)